.text
.code16
#define ASM
#include "asmcode.h"
#include "multiboot.h"
.code32
EXTERN(_GetExtendedMemorySize)
//
// get extended memory size in KB
//
pushl %edx
pushl %ecx
pushl %ebx
call switch_to_real
.code16
movw $0xe801,%ax
int $0x15
jc .oldstylemem
cmpw $0,%ax
je .cmem
andl $0xffff,%ebx
shll $6,%ebx
andl $0xffff,%eax
add %ebx,%eax
jmp .done_mem
.cmem:
cmpw $0,%cx
je .oldstylemem
andl $0xffff,%edx
shll $6,%edx
andl $0xffff,%ecx
addl %ecx,%edx
movl %edx,%eax
jmp .done_mem
.oldstylemem:
// int 15h opt e801 don't work , try int 15h, option 88h
movb $0x88,%ah
int $0x15
cmp $0,%ax
je .cmosmem
movzwl %ax,%eax
jmp .done_mem
.cmosmem:
// int 15h opt 88h don't work , try read cmos
xorl %eax,%eax
movb $0x31,%al
outb %al,$0x70
inb $0x71,%al
andl $0xffff,%eax // clear carry
shll $8,%eax
.done_mem:
/* Save return value */
movl %eax,%edx
call switch_to_prot
.code32
/* Restore return value */
movl %edx,%eax
popl %ebx
popl %ecx
popl %edx
ret
.code32
EXTERN(_GetConventionalMemorySize)
//
// get conventional memory size in KB
//
pushl %edx
call switch_to_real
.code16
xorl %eax,%eax
int $0x12
/*xorl %eax,%eax
movb $0x30,%al
outb %al,$0x70
inb $0x71,%al
andl $0xffff,%eax*/ // clear carry
/* Save return value */
movl %eax,%edx
call switch_to_prot
.code32
/* Restore return value */
movl %edx,%eax
popl %edx
ret
.code32
_gbmm_mem_map_length:
.long 0
_gbmm_memory_map_addr:
.long 0
EXTERN(_GetBiosMemoryMap)
//
// Retrieve BIOS memory map if available
//
pushl %edx
pushl %ecx
pushl %ebx
pushl %edi
movl $0,_gbmm_mem_map_length
/* Get memory map address off stack */
movl 0x10(%esp),%eax
movl %eax,_gbmm_memory_map_addr
call switch_to_real
.code16
xorl %ebx,%ebx
movl _gbmm_memory_map_addr,%edi
.mmap_next:
movl $0x534D4150,%edx // 'SMAP'
movl $/*sizeof(memory_map_t)*/24,%ecx
movl 0xE820,%eax
int $0x15
jc .done_mmap
cmpl $0x534D4150,%eax // 'SMAP'
jne .done_mmap
addl $/*sizeof(memory_map_t)*/24,%edi
addl $/*sizeof(memory_map_t)*/24,_gbmm_mem_map_length
cmpl $0,%ebx
jne .mmap_next
.done_mmap:
call switch_to_prot
.code32
/* Get return value */
movl _gbmm_mem_map_length,%eax
popl %edi
popl %ebx
popl %ecx
popl %edx
ret
